A pulse damper is actually a chamber stuffed with an easily compressed fluid and a versatile diaphragm. In the course of the piston’s forward stroke the fluid in the heartbeat damper is compressed. In the event the piston withdraws to refill the pump, pressure through the growing fluid in the pulse damper maintains the stream level.

5.1 exhibits an illustration of a normal HPLC instrument, that has various critical elements: reservoirs that retailer the cellular period; a pump for pushing the mobile section throughout the system; an injector for introducing the sample; a column for separating the sample into its component elements; plus a detector for monitoring the eluent because it will come from the column. Enable’s take into account Every single of such elements.
Degasser assists take away the air bubbles That could be fashioned while in the cellular period. The development with the gasoline will cause fluctuation inside the baseline. It takes advantage of a Unique polymer membrane tube acquiring many little pores to eliminate the gases.

Degassing is attained in numerous ways, but the most typical are the use of a vacuum pump or sparging with the inert gas, for instance He, which has a very low solubility within the mobile phase. Particulate elements, which can clog the HPLC tubing or column, are taken out by filtering the solvents.
The detector displays the eluent since it exits the column. Different detectors are applied according to the compounds staying analyzed and the demanded sensitivity.
An HPLC commonly incorporates two columns: an analytical column, and that is liable for the separation, and a guard column that may be positioned prior to the analytical column to check here guard it from contamination.
